#4f881d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f881d is composed of 31% red, 53.3%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 92 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 32.4%. #4f881d color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ff3a with #001100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#4f881d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f881d has RGB values of R:79, G:136,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 5212189.

Shades and Tints of #4f881d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040701 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f881d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525550 is the less saturated color, while #4da104 is the most saturated one.
